Question 1

Formic acid (HCO2H, Ka = 1.8 × 10-4) is the principal component in the venom of stinging ants. What is the molarity of a formic acid solution if 25.00 mL of the formic acid solution requires 44.80 mL of 0.0567 M NaOH to reach the equivalence point?
◦ 0.0134 M
◦ 0.0316 M
◦ 0.102 M
◦ 0.0567 M

Question 2

What is the pH of the resulting solution if 40.00 mL of 0.10 M acetic acid is added to 10.00 mL of 0.10 M NaOH? Assume that the volumes of the solutions are additive. Ka = 1.8 × 10-5 for CH3CO2H
◦ 8.78
◦ 4.27
◦ 5.22
◦ 9.73

Did you know?

When Gabriel Fahrenheit invented the first mercury thermometer, he called "zero degrees" the lowest temperature he was able to attain with a mixture of ice and salt. For the upper point of his scale, he used 96°, which he measured as normal human body temperature (we know it to be 98.6° today because of more accurate thermometers).
